Review of Stars at Noon (2022) by Nicholas Barber for BBC — 26 May 2022
Partly because the characters look so healthily pretty, and partly because the mood is so woozy, The Stars at Noon feels more like a stylish pastiche of a Graham Greene novel than the story of real people battling their way out of a difficult, potentially deadly situation.
It's beautifully made, but to enjoy it you have to relax, and let it wash over you.
